The Philippines operates a dual, still-consolidating licensing perimeter for crypto: the SEC requires authorization to offer 'crypto asset services' (effective 5 July 2025), while the BSP separately requires a Virtual Asset Service Provider (VASP) license for entities facilitating crypto payment/transaction rails. The two regimes are non-substitutable — SEC sandbox participation does not satisfy the BSP VASP requirement. BSP also imposed a multi-year moratorium on new VASP applications from Sept 2022, complicating entry. Multiple major offshore exchanges have been publicly named as unauthorized.

The Philippines has no comprehensive statutory taxonomy for crypto-assets distinguishing security tokens, utility tokens, stablecoins, or NFTs. The SEC's 2023 draft rules under the Financial Products and Services Consumer Protection Act (FPSCPA) propose bringing 'tokenized securities products' within the existing securities definition, but a finalized, comprehensive classification framework has not been confirmed via primary source at this run.

No Philippine primary-source regulation specifically addressing staking, DeFi lending, DEX operation, mining, node operation, validator activity, or tokenization as discrete on-chain activities was located. Such activity, if conducted commercially, would likely fall under the general SEC crypto-asset-service or BSP VASP licensing perimeter, but no activity-specific rules are confirmed.

The Philippines has no comprehensive stablecoin statute. The only confirmed authorization is BSP's approval, under its Regulatory Sandbox Framework, for Coins.ph to pilot a peso-referenced stablecoin (PHPC) backed by cash and cash-equivalents held in Philippine bank accounts. No general reserve-requirement, redemption-right, disclosure, or systemic-designation regime for stablecoins has been confirmed via primary source.

Consumer protection for crypto activity is being built on two tracks: (i) SEC public warnings/advisories against unauthorized platforms, and (ii) the broader Financial Products and Services Consumer Protection Act (FPSCPA) implementing rules, which the SEC's 2023 draft proposed extending to crypto/tokenized securities via disclosure, fair market conduct, and dispute-resolution obligations.

No dedicated Bureau of Internal Revenue (BIR) issuance specifically classifying the income-tax, capital-gains, VAT, or withholding treatment of crypto-assets has been confirmed via primary source. The Department of Finance has previously taken the position that income from blockchain-based games/tokens (e.g., Axie Infinity SLP) constitutes taxable Philippine-source income, but this is a policy statement rather than a confirmed binding BIR circular directly addressing crypto more broadly.

No PH-specific outbound-restriction statute or crypto-specific cross-border reporting threshold was located. However, BSP's June 2026 position on Binance/BlockShoals establishes a de facto cross-border gating mechanism: an offshore exchange's local partner must integrate with a BSP-licensed domestic VASP before onboarding users through offshore infrastructure, and SEC sandbox participation does not substitute for this requirement.

Disambiguation context only: the SEC's July 2025 crypto-asset-service rules bundle AML systems, suspicious transaction reporting, and customer due diligence into the licensing authorization requirement (see crypto_licensing module), and BSP VASP supervision similarly incorporates AML/CFT expectations consistent with FATF Recommendation 15.
